Sky Garage for the Rich and Famous

Melbourne apartment taking parking to the next level – Sky Garage.

Sky Garage
First, you need the cash and then you need the car. No point parking your 04 Ford Futura there
LISA ALLEN from the Australian has an interesting story on a new development in St Kilda. Sign me up Scotty! A Sky garage has become prevalent in Singapore and the USA, and now it’s coming down under.
“Forget valet parking. A new apartment block on St Kilda Road will offer residents — provided they have a spare $6 million — the chance to live with the latest German technology with the nation’s first “sky garage”.
Long a feature of Singapore’s and New York’s up-market developments the apartments in Melbourne’s Neue Grand will showcase the owner’s luxury vehicles in a glass display port adjacent to the main living area.

The 20-storey building fronting 613 St Kilda Road with 19 residential levels is designed by award-winning architecture firm Rothelowman and will feature one 350sq m apartment per level.

Plans for the sky garage are awaiting final approval.

 

 

With an average price of $6 million, each full-floor apartment will offer at least three bedrooms.

Residents will drive their ­vehicle into the automated parking system from the ground floor, where licence plate recognition will allow for secure entry.

Developer Growland, which is developing $2 billion worth of projects in Victoria, says construction on the purchased St Kilda Road site will start next year.

Once exiting the vehicle, residents will scan a pass to their own lift, and while protecting their privacy the lift takes the resident to their apartment without revealing the dwelling’s floor number.

The high-speed automated parking system will then automatically send the resident’s vehicle skywards and park it in a private double-space display port in the apartment.

For convenience, a basement parking space will offer a place for residents’ “everyday” car.

Residents will also be greeted by a concierge in the regal ­entrance, and once at their level will access their apartments via fingerprint recognition software. ­

Inside the residences, blinds and lights will be controlled through hi-tech home automation.

Rothelowman will work with buyers to ensure each apartment is tailored to suit their unique requirements.

The prized penthouse apartment will enjoy exclusive access to a private rooftop and garden offering city and bay views, with the opportunity to combine the top two floors for a palatial double-storey residence.

Shane Rothe, founding principal of Rothelowman, said Neue Grand was aimed at discerning downsizers looking for new residences that retained the opulence and scale of their former homes.

“The ability to showcase premium cars is a rare opportunity in Australia. These apartments will also tap into a new middle-aged professional market made up of people who are downsizing earlier for the convenience of lifestyle.

“Easy access to the gym, storage within the residences for golf clubs, and the selectivity of only one apartment per floor will appeal to their mindset alongside the chance to exhibit their high-end vehicles.

Growland CEO Ronald Chan says the company is proud to be the first developer to bring this grand garage technology to Australia and Melbourne where there is significant demand from buyers at the prestige end of the market.

Growland chairman and founder Bruce Chan says this project is elite in every way; from the exclusive full-floor apartments to the oversized layout and of course the sky garage. “It is truly the only project in Australia that will offer all the benefits of a luxury home with the convenience and amenity of a penthouse apartment.”
